SMM Flash News】 Patriot Battery Metals Inc. has expanded the lithium ore resources at its Sheguetshuwana project in Quebec, Canada, and is scheduled to announce the feasibility study results by September. Compared to the estimates in August 2024, the updated inferred resources at the Nova Zone/CV5 have increased by 30%, while those at the Vega Zone/CV13 have surged by 306%. The high-grade ore zones are all classified as inferred resources, with the potential for further expansion. Currently, the Sheguetshuwana ore resources are estimated at 108 million mt, with a lithium oxide grade of 1.4%, equivalent to 3.8 million mt of lithium carbonate equivalent (LCE). The inferred ore resources are estimated at 33.3 million mt, with a lithium oxide grade of 1.3%, equivalent to 1 million mt of LCE.
